Updated Monday, 26th April 2021, 4:32 pm New faces on the way at Milton Keynes Council even before a vote is cast – and why you will get two borough votes in some wards At least 11 new faces will be elected to serve as councillors in Milton Keynes borough following the elections on May 6 – and that’s GUARANTEED. A combination of factors have come together to see more than half the 21 seats up for grabs this time round not being fought by sitting councillors. A ballot box Most of the seats up for election would have been fought in May 2020 but were postponed because of the pandemic. May 2021 was due to be a “fallow” year, with no elections, but the postponements have filled the gap for election junkies. ....
